ESTAH SAP (EHS: Application-dependent data for report generation) Table details
Description: EHS: Application-dependent data for report generation
Table field list including key, data, relationships and ABAP select examples
ESTAH is a standard SAP Table which is used to store EHS: Application-dependent data for report generation data and is available within R/3 SAP systems depending on the version and release level.
The ESTAH table consists of various fields, each holding specific information or linking keys about EHS: Application-dependent data for report generation data available in SAP. These include ADDID (Reference number of application-dependent data), OBJECT (Partial Key: Object Entry of ADD), ATTRIB (Partial key: object entry attribute), ORD (Partial key: sort sequence of objects).. See below for full list along with technical details, documentation, text table, check tables, foreign key relationships, conversion routines, relevant tcodes and example ABAP select code etc. .
Delivery Class: L - Table for storing temporary data, is delivered emptyDisplay/Maintenance via tcode SM30: Display/Maintenance Allowed but with Restrictions
SAP enhancement categories: Not classified
SAP ESTAH table fields - Full list of fields found in SAP data dictionary
Field | Description | Data Element | Data Type | length (Dec) | Check table | Conversion Routine | Domain Name | MemoryID | SHLP |
MANDT | Client | MANDT | CLNT | 3 | T000 | MANDT | |||
ADDID | Reference number of application-dependent data | CVDEADDID | CHAR | 20 | CVDDADDID | ||||
OBJECT | Partial Key: Object Entry of ADD | CVDEOBJECT | CHAR | 30 | CVDDOBJECT | ||||
ATTRIB | Partial key: object entry attribute | CVDEATTRIB | CHAR | 30 | CVDDATTRIB | ||||
ORD | Partial key: sort sequence of objects | CVDEORD | NUMC | 4 | CVDDORD | ||||
VALUETYPE | Value Type of a Parameter Value | CVDEVALTYP | CHAR | 1 | CVDDVALTYP | ||||
VALUE | General Extension Field | CVDEVALUE | CHAR | 132 | CVDDVALUE | ||||
TDOBJECT | Texts: Application Object | TDOBJECT | CHAR | 10 | Assigned to domain | TDOBJECT | |||
TDID | Text ID | TDID | CHAR | 4 | Assigned to domain | TDID | |||
TDNAME | TDIC text name | TDNAME | CHAR | 16 | TDCHAR16 | ||||
TDSPRAS | Language key | TDSPRAS | LANG | 1 | Assigned to domain | ISOLA | SPRAS |
Key field | Non-key field |
How do I retrieve data from SAP table ESTAH using ABAP code
The following ABAP code Example will allow you to do a basic selection on ESTAH to SELECT all data from the tableDATA: WA_ESTAH TYPE ESTAH.
SELECT SINGLE *
FROM ESTAH
INTO CORRESPONDING FIELDS OF WA_ESTAH
WHERE...
